Johan Comparat is a leading astrophysicist whose work centers on large-scale structure, dark energy, and the evolution of galaxies across cosmic time. He has made pivotal contributions to two of the most ambitious spectroscopic surveys ever undertaken. As a key member of the Dark Energy Spectroscopic Instrument (DESI) collaboration, Comparat helped design and implement the instrument that now maps tens of millions of galaxies and quasars. His work on DESI’s instrument design—detailed in a paper with over 230 citations—enables precise measurements of baryon acoustic oscillations and redshift-space distortions, directly probing the nature of dark energy. More recently, Comparat is advancing the Sloan Digital Sky Survey-V (SDSS-V), the first all-sky, multi-epoch, optical-to-infrared spectroscopic survey. This pioneering "panoptic" approach will revolutionize our understanding of black hole growth, stellar evolution, and the Milky Way’s structure. With a career defined by building the next generation of cosmological tools, Comparat’s impact is measured not only in citations but in the fundamental data that will shape astrophysics for decades.
